The theme of this Tsuba is Chokaro, Zhang Guo Lao. The depiction of Chokaro riding a donkey is a popular theme. He was one of the hermits of the Tang Dynasty in China. He was always rode a white donkey and traveled thousands of miles in a day using illusions. When he rests, he folds his donkey and places it within a gourd, which he hangs from his waist. When he needed to ride, he would squirt water from the gourd then the donkey would appear. Judging from the features of the work, it was likely crafted by the Mito Tradition during the late Edo Period. It is well crafted Tsuba used for a Wakizashi style Koshirae.
